Shaving experiment – is cheapest best?

Can Disposable Razors Hack it?

In the interests of my readers I have conducted ‘research’ today.

I was in Sainsbury’s yesterday and remembered that I needed new blades for my Gillette fusion razor – The shopping fairy normally organises for them to arrive with the Tesco delivery, I rarely have to buy them.

Consequently I’ve not had a conscious reminder of their cost for a long time, but £5 raised my eyebrows.

Finn pointed out that I could buy a pack of 5 disposables for 13p and I wondered – surely something with just one function couldn’t be that bad?

So, the question is – are the disposables good enough, or are they a false economy?

Well, I had a three day growth, but even so, I don’t regard this as a challenge – I know people who look like Desperate Dan from the Dandy by mid afternoon and shave twice a day, I’m not like that, I can still get away with it on day 2.

The Gillette (Other brands are available), even though it’s a bit aged, would have breezed through this job.

The disposable – well, ‘hacked’ is the word I need here – actually quite painful and bizarrely it left patches unshaved, with no sense that it was doing the job. I actually returned to the Gillette to ‘just finish off’. My cheeks still feel strange even now.

Conclusion

Well folks – I was going to say ‘gents’, but I guess the research applies to all -  Disposable Razors -  The economy will have to get pretty bad before I use these again.
